EGR does help with NOx emissions, but it's a secondary pollution.
NOx hardly qualifies as secondary pollution, it's about the most harmfull thing to come out of the exhaust !

Biodiesel generates around 10% more NOx than regular diesel, so disabling the EGR while on biodiesel is not the best of options.


If your car has EGR, please keep it operational !
Better mileage at the expense of polluting MORE is not my idea of driving more environmentally friendly.
